4 votos

adb install apk se ha realizado con éxito en el dispositivo (o emulador), pero no se ha encontrado

Estoy utilizando la línea de comandos para instalar apk en dispositivos y emuladores. Sólo hay un dispositivo a la vez, así que no tengo que especificar el nombre del dispositivo.

adb install file.apk

de salida:

Performing Streamed Install
Success

Compruebo en el dispositivo (o emulador), pero no encuentro la aplicación instalada. ¿Podríais ayudarme, por favor?

1 votos

" no puedo encontrar la aplicación instalada "¿Te refieres a que no se muestra en el lanzador (como ocurre con las aplicaciones que no tienen actividad en el lanzador), o en la lista de Ajustes-Aplicaciones?

0 votos

Mi aplicación tiene la actividad del lanzador. "no puede encontrar la aplicación instalada en el dispositivo" significa literalmente que no veo la aplicación instalada en el dispositivo o emulador.

1 votos

Compruebe si el paquete aparece en la salida de adb shell pm list packages . Si es así, el problema es con su aplicación per se porque la aplicación sigue instalada. En ese caso puede intentar lanzar directamente una actividad a través de adb. Si no, tendrías que indagar en logcat para ver qué pasa cuando se instala el apk.

1voto

Hiro Puntos 1

No es una broma. En mi caso, estaba comparando dos aplicaciones (app1 y app2) y lo que realmente estaba haciendo era instalar la app2 (adb install en el directorio app2 donde la ruta y el nombre del archivo apk resultaban ser idénticos a los de la app1), cuando en realidad quería instalar la app1, y simplemente decía "Install Success", lo cual era cierto; la app2 estaba efectivamente instalada.

PreguntAndroid.com

PreguntAndroid es una comunidad de usuarios de Android en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X